well I have been playing it a lot, there are some issues and bugs, some mechanics are simplified, but on the whole a very nice game:
-surface warfare is on the whole well done: gunnery, damage control, star shells, formation control, radar. Shell/torpedo damage and damage control seem about right. -submarine and ASW is fairly basic; playing through the tutorials and reading the manual is a must. A lot of stuff in there, the Devs may have tried to stuff too much into one game. Still have not tried carriers, air battles, the campaign, having too much fun replaying the historical night surface actions in the Solomons: Savo Island, Cape Esperance, both Naval battles of Guadalcanal, Tassafaronga, Kula Gulf, etc. If you are into WW2 surface naval warfare, this is a must buy.
